[I] an OpenGL clone of Tron
[T] GLTron is inspired by the movie TRON. Or more exactly, by all the games
[T] that where inspired by the movie TRON.
[T]
[T] You steer a futuristic bike, called lightcycle. Combat takes place in a
[T] rectangular arena. Your bike leaves a trail behind, which is like a
[T] wall. The goal is to force the other players to drive into a wall.
[T] The winner is the last player alive.
[T]
[T] NOTE: this package _needs_ a supported 3d video accelerator.
